WHYNOT, Marion L. - 78, of Milton, Queens County, passed away peacefully in Halifax Infirmary on Tuesday, October 21, 2014. Born in Liverpool, she was a daughter of the late Guy and Lilly (Jollimore) White. Marion was a former cashier with Dominion Stores and worked in the kitchen at Queens General Hospital, Liverpool for a number of years before her retirement. She served as a Girl Guide Leader for 12 years and was an avid minor hockey grandmother as well as attending any events her grandchildren were involved in. Marion was known for knitting mittens for a Dartmouth church which were distributed to the neighborhood children. She loved family events, spending time at the cabin in Port Joli and her furry “grandbabies”. She will be fondly remembered and sadly missed by close friends and by her family especially her grandchildren. She is survived by her husband of 59 years Clyde D. “Buddy”, daughters Charlotte (Graham) Parks of Milton, Christine “Chrissy” Hunt of Greenfield, grandchildren Jillian and Jennifer Parks and Ezekiel “Zeke” and Elijah “Eli” Hunt, sister Florence Robar of Dartmouth, brother Jack (Charlotte) of Western Head. Predeceased by her sister Joan Croft and brother Maurice. Cremation has taken place under the direction of Chandlers’ Funeral Home, Liverpool. At Marion’s request, there will be no funeral service.
